Job description
Overview

Customer Service Advisor

Annual Salary: 26,000- 30,000pa (dependent on experience)

Location: Saffron Walden

Job Type: Full-time, Permanent

Working Hours: Monday to Friday, 9am to 5pm

REED Cambridge are delighted to be supporting a leading UK insurance company in their search for a Customer Service Advisor to join their Saffron Walden agency. With over 110 years of providing quality insurance products and services, they are committed to delivering exceptional service to their customers. This role offers an exciting opportunity to be part of a first-class team dedicated to excellence in customer service.

Responsibilities
  • Provide outstanding service to both existing and new customers.
  • Handle new sales inquiries, existing policy changes and claims with proactive enthusiasm.
  • Ensure a seamless customer experience by maintaining high standards of communication and service.
  • Work within a compliant environment, managing a complex workload and adhering to strict deadlines.
  • Utilise various IT systems proficiently, including Microsoft Office, to manage customer interactions and data.
Qualifications
  • Proven experience in a customer service role, desirably within the insurance industry
  • Excellent telephone manner and communication skills.
  • Superb attention to detail and a flexible, people-oriented approach.
  • Ability to work to strict deadlines and manage a complex workload.
  • Proficient IT user, quick to adapt to new systems.
  • Minimum of 5 GCSEs (or equivalent) at grade C or above, including Maths and English.
Benefits
  • 25 days holiday entitlement plus bank holidays.
  • Health & Wellbeing plan.
  • Pension Scheme with employer contributions.

This role is not just a job but a career opportunity within a supportive environment where you will receive full product and systems training.
